Surya’s Maatraan will decide Gautham Menon’s Neethaane En Ponvasantham release
Director Gautham Menon has said that Neethaane En Ponvasantham will hit the screens either in August or September but the exact date will be decided only after the release date of Surya’s Maatraan is out.
The ace director has said that he doesn’t want Neethaane En Ponvasantham to compete with the ‘big Maatraan’ and hence is bidding his time for its release.
On the film’s audio launch, Gautham Menon said that he is planning it to be held during the first week of July and there is a possibility of it being launched on July 1st. The date will be announced formally is a few days’ time, he said.
Neethaane En Ponvasantham’s music has been scored by maestro Ilayaraja and the film stars Jeeva and Samantha as the lead pair.
Maatraan to be shot in Alaska
KV Anand who is known for songs in fresh locations in all his films is on a location hunt to shoot his last song from forthcoming ‘Maatraan‘. It is said that the team has decided to shoot in some unseen exotic locales of Alaska in the US!
The shoot will take place sometime in June and it will be a romantic number featuring Surya and Kajal Agarwal. The song will be composed shortly by Harris Jayaraj.
‘Maatraan‘ featuring Surya and Kajal Agarwal is an action thriller that’s touted to see Surya in two different and entirely contrast roles, more like a Suriya vs. Suriya. The film has dialogues penned by writer duo Suba.
‘Maatraan‘ has performance capture technology utilized in some key action scenes, which is touted to be the first time ever for an Indian film.
